Frozen Meat.

.. . ♦ TRICKS OP THE TRADE. From Mark Lane ' Express ' of 27th May it appears that certain doings of one of the middlemen of the Central Meat Market of a most startling kind havo reoentlyjcome to light in the HighCourt of London. An owner of carcases consigned them to one of (he four hundred agents who sell on commission, and was not satisfied with the return that was sent to him. He commenced proceed- [ ings, we Are told, and asked for the production of the agent's books. This was strenuously opposed, but the Court decided the request was a reasonable one, and granted it. Then the case disappeared from view until it transpired that the defendant had been able to settle the matter by payment of L7OOO and costs. I " The nalnral deduotioa from such a ; state of affairs is (says the • Express ') that there must be something very rotten in the London Central Meat Market. The agent alone could not act in this way, or he would soon lose all bis businesc When a man can afford to pay L7OOO to settle a dispute of this kind, he muit have made: huge profits. If this were ah exception it would mean that others would soon gel the trade, for one man could not expect to keep it unless he returned as good profits as others."
